Adventures in Babysitting (PG-13) - 25th Anniversary Edition

Rotten Tomatoes rating: 78%

A classic from July 3, 1987, Adventures in Babysitting stars Elisabeth Shue as beleaguered babysitter Chris Parker – a 17 year old who’d rather be out with her boyfriend than watching over 15 year old Brad (Keith Coogan) and 8 year old Sara (Mia Brewton). When she gets a call from her friend Brenda (Penelope Ann Miller) who has run away from home, she takes her charges – along with Brad’s friend Daryl Coopersmith (Anthony Rapp) – into the mean streets of Chicago to get her friend and take her home. Of course, shenanigans ensue, but it’s of the most entertaining variety. The movie did well for itself in theaters, with a two week stint at #4 in the Top 5. It was considered a success, making over $34 million on its $7 million budget. This is a good trip down memory lane, and I can’t recommend it highly enough.

 

Dr. Seuss’ The Lorax Combo Pack

The imaginative world of Dr. Seuss comes to life like never before in this visually spectacular adventure from the creators of Despicable Me! Twelve-year-old Ted will do anything to find a real live Truffula Tree in order to impress the girl of his dreams. As he embarks on his journey, Ted discovers the incredible story of the Lorax, a grumpy but charming creature who speaks for the trees. Featuring the voice talents of Danny DeVito, Ed Helms, Zac Efron, Taylor Swift, Rob Riggle, Jenny Slate, and Betty White, Dr. Seuss’ The Lorax is filled with hilarious fun for everyone!
